Documents Required For Renting A Bike In Bali

blog-images

First things first! Having proper licensing is essential when you ride a motorbike in Bali. Local police actively check for valid licenses and impose significant fines on unlicensed riders.

Ensure all documentation is complete before hitting Bali's roads. Or, explore one of these two options to understand more about documentation.

Option 1: International Driver's License (Recommended)

  1. Carry a valid International Driving Permit (IDP) with Category A for motorcycles. It must be obtained in your home country before traveling.
  2. Carry a National driver's license from your home country.
  3. Bring Passport for identity verification.

Option 2: Temporary Tourist License

If you don't have an International Driver's License, you can apply for a Temporary Tourist Motorcyclist License at local police stations.

Application Requirements:

  1. Passport-size photographs
  2. Booking confirmation details
  3. Valid passport
  4. Completed application form

Cost: ₹1,725/- (SGD 25) or (321,389 IDR)

Where: Any nearby police station in Bali

Benefits: Prevents hefty penalty charges from local police

Cost Of Renting A Bike In Bali

The cost of renting a bike in Bali remains budget-friendly, making it an ideal choice for travelers seeking affordable transportation.

How Much You Pay Depends On:

  • Rental Duration: Longer rentals often get better daily rates.
  • Engine Size: Smaller engines (lower cc) cost less, bigger engines cost more.
  • Bike Condition: Most rental bikes are well-maintained and reliable.

Price Variations to Expect:

  • High season (holidays/festivals) = higher prices
  • Low season = better deals and discounts

Approx Price Range:

  • Per Day: ₹165/- to ₹270/- (30,000 to 50,000 IDR)
  • Per Week: ₹1,075/- to ₹1,345/- (200,000 to 250,000 IDR)

Where To Rent Bikes In Bali?

Local operators run most bike rental services, conveniently located near popular tourist areas.

Popular Beach Areas:

  1. Major beach resort zones like Kuta, Sanur and Jimbaran have numerous rental shops owned and operated by locals.
  2. You'll also find rentals in quieter, scenic locations such as Candidasa in East Bali.

How to Spot Rental Shops:

Look for parked motorbikes displaying signs on their number plates or handlebars that say:

  • "Motorbikes for Rent"
  • "Car and Motorcycle Rental"

Most of these local businesses offer both cars and bike rental in Bali.

Useful Tips To Rent & Return The Bikes In Bali

Planning to explore Bali on two wheels? These practical travel tips will help you navigate bike rentals safely and avoid common pitfalls during your island adventure.

Pre-Rental Protocols:

  • Familiarise yourself with the bike and its controls.
  • Examine the bike’s safety - Effective brakes, responsive throttle, working headlights switches, etc. Turn them all on, including revving the engine.
  • Note that most rental bikes have automatic gears, referred to as ‘matic’, with front and rear brakes being handle lever brakes.
  • It’s much safer to use them together at the same time, or applying the back brake before the front. Get a proper helmet with a strap that fits well.
  • Check your bike for any visible damage, including scratches. Ensure the owner acknowledges them.
  • Avoid being a victim of a scam where you are blamed for minor damages. Even consider snapping photos as proof.

Essential Safety and Legal Guidelines:

  • Always wear a helmet while riding. Bali police actively enforce this rule and impose heavy fines on violators.
  • Riding with the help of a GPS or GPS-enabled smartphone can be a great help while traveling in Bali.
  • Always remember to check your fuel levels while on the road. Automatic gear scooters tend to drain faster than manual gear types.
  • Refill at nearby gas stations as needed.

Traffic Compliance:

  • Follow all traffic regulations strictly.
  • Stop at red lights and obey traffic signs.
  • Never drink and drive.
  • Avoid speeding and limit passengers to two people maximum per bike.

Security Measures:

  • Keep your bike keys safe and secure.
  • Never lend your rental bike to others.
  • Most rental bikes lack insurance coverage. So, it's recommended to get your own or rent from companies that offer it.

Return and Inspection Requirements:

  • Return your rented bike on time to avoid penalty charges.
  • Rental companies thoroughly inspect vehicles upon return, checking for scratches, dents, broken mirrors, and seat cover damage.
  • Any discovered damage will result in repair costs being charged to you.
  • Choose reputable rental companies that offer convenient drop-off services, especially helpful for tourists exploring different areas of the island.
  • If accidents, theft, or serious mechanical issues occur, contact your rental company immediately.

How To Rent A Bike In Bali - Quick Summary

blog-images

For travelers who wants to explore the guide to renting a bike in Bali, here's everything you need to know:

Finding Rentals: Look for rental shops in popular tourist areas like Kuta, Sanur, and Jimbaran. Simply spot parked bikes with "Motorbikes for Rent" signs, or ask your hotel to arrange pickup and drop-off services for added convenience.

Required Documents: You need an International Driving Permit with Category A plus your passport. Alternatively, get a temporary tourist license at any police station for ₹1,725 with passport photos and booking confirmation details.

Pricing: Daily rentals cost ₹165-₹270, while weekly rates range from ₹1,075-₹1,345. Prices depend on bike type, season, and rental duration, with smaller engines costing less than premium motorcycles.

Pre-Rental Inspection: Always check the bike for existing damage and take photos as proof. Test brakes, lights, throttle, and engine before accepting. Ensure the owner acknowledges any scratches to avoid scam charges later.

Safety Requirements: Wear helmets at all times (heavy police fines apply), follow traffic rules strictly, never drink and drive, and limit passengers to two people maximum per motorcycle.

Return Process: Return bikes on time to avoid penalties. Expect thorough damage inspections, and be prepared to pay for any new scratches, dents, or mechanical issues discovered during return.
